ISO/IEC JTC1/SC22/WG5 N1425 Announcement Meeting of ISO/IEC JTC1/SC22/WG5 30 July to 3 August 2001 British Standards Institution 389 Chiswick High Road, London W4 4AL The next meeting of WG5 will be held at the Headquarters of the British Standards Institution, 389 Chiswick High Road, London W4 4AL, from 30th July to 3rd August, 2001. The local organizer is David Muxworthy (d.muxworthy@ed.ac.uk). 1. OBJECTIVES OF THE MEETING There are three major items of business for this meeting: A. Processing of interpretations of the Fortran 95 standard. The most important task for the meeting will be the construction a draft for Corrigendum 2 to the Fortran 95 standard. This will involve the consideration of all defect reports (N1427) that indicate a need for edits to the Fortran 95 standard. B. Review of the content of Fortran 2000 WG5 will review its plans for the content of Fortran 2000 (N1413) and prepare a summary of the changes from Fortran 95. If any item in the list of required contents still needs technical work, WG5 will provide assistance to J3 in this task. C. Review of the Fortran 2000 working draft WG5 will review the current Fortran 2000 working draft and provide suggestions for changes for consideration at the next J3 meeting. 2.
